### Changed: NIGHTLY_REINDEX_KEY renamed

In Lumenquery 3.2, the setting formerly called NIGHTLY_REINDEX_KEY is now SEARCH_REINDEX_AUTH to match the scheduler's naming scheme. The old name is ignored as of this release, so the nightly reindex will silently skip authentication if you don't migrate. On-call: verify before the 02:00 window. Your env file must now contain this line:

sealed setting: LEDGER_TOKEN13=5d842615a26d7

Subject: Exam crate — Fellgate College, Thursday

Dispatch: sealed exam crate goes out Thursday, 07:00 sharp. Receiving site is the Fellgate College registry office, side entrance only. Crate seals were applied yesterday; numbers are on the manifest. No substitutions on driver, no stops, no photos of the crate. Registry staff must check both seals before accepting. If seals look disturbed, refuse delivery and call me before anything moves. Log arrival time on the run sheet. Courier hand-over instruction is directly below.

dispatch memo: the eliath belael courier leaves the praox ledger at gate 8841 under passcode 017589

Image slimming for the Quillhaven services is handled by the stripdown stage in the build pipeline. Maintainers should not add OS packages to the final layer; put them in the builder stage instead. Size regressions over 10% fail CI. The slimming report job records layer diffs per build, and it writes those results to the database reachable via the following.

primary connection of yagep-kahip = redis://giliel_svc:zYiKsLL2PLpfPL@db-348f.xolmarsys.corp:5432/fenwyn

Management Meeting Minutes — Gross-Margin Review

Present: executive team. For the board.

Margins fell 1.8 points on the Ferrow line; freight and input costs cited. Corrective actions agreed: renegotiate the Aldmere supply contract, trim low-margin SKUs, raise list prices 3% in the Venholt territory. Ops to report progress in four weeks. Finance flagged currency exposure as a secondary risk. No objections recorded. Actions assigned and minuted. The confidential note on the recovery plan is set out below.

internal memo for kawip-hadug: Headcount on the Wenwyn team goes from 7 to 140 by the end of January. Gross margin on Wenwyn came in at 20 percent against a plan of 15 percent.